Image quality, 35-233 optical zoom, Ease of use.
Digital read out under low light impossible to read. Battery Life. No bundled battery charger and set of batteries.
Digital read out horrible under low light situations. Battery life used quickly as is common with other digital camera's. A bundled charger and batteries would make this a better value purchase. Also a 240V power cord should have been bundled. Excellent image picking up all fine detail. A good family point and shoot design and some added functionality for those that like to delve for a better image under some conditions. However more manual functionality would be better. Flash worked great under low light with pleasing results. However seeing the subject was impossible under low light. Bundled software is good and manual v good. Movie and sound function worked well with a 60sec movie possible out of the box. Overall this has been a good family purchase with great image quality.
